What is a Psychological Assessment?
A psychological assessment is a combination of clinical interviews, standardized tests, and other diagnostic tools that are utilized to recognize emotional and behavioral issues. It can also be used to determine whether a psychological health issue is triggered by a physical health problem or another concern like drug or alcoholism.
The procedure begins with the health professional performing an interview and getting as much info as possible from the client. This might include asking about the length of time the client has been experiencing symptoms, analyzing medical records, and speaking with other individuals who understand the individual, such as friends or relative. It is also important to show the health professional any prescription or over the counter medication you are taking, along with any supplements or herbs you are taking in.
During the psychological examination, the health professional will administer a range of standardized tests and surveys that can be finished orally or written. This will allow them to get a much better understanding of the person's thinking and behavior, such as character characteristics, mood disorders, or memory. Psychologists are likewise able to examine cognitive abilities like intelligence and processing speed, and can use educational or accomplishment testing to assist pinpoint discovering impairments, such as dyslexia.
After the tests have been administered, the health professional will examine the outcomes and get to a diagnosis. They will likewise write a report of their findings and use any treatment suggestions they feel would be valuable to you. They will go over these with you in a feedback session, where they can respond to any concerns you have and describe how they came to their conclusions.

How Does a Psychological Assessment Work?
Psychological evaluations, likewise referred to as psych evals, are frequently used by mental health professionals to detect psychological conditions and figure out the best course of treatment for an individual. These evaluations can help individuals get a much better understanding of their idea patterns and make positive changes in their lives. These types of evaluations can be conducted by psychologists, psychiatric nurse specialists, or other certified mental health professionals.
The psychological assessment procedure normally involves some type of standardized testing, clinical interviews, and observations. This consists of details about the individual's medical history, household history, and any existing medication or supplements the client might be taking. The evaluator will also keep in mind any physical symptoms the individual is experiencing together with their daily behavior and social interactions.
Standardized tests are developed to evaluate an individual's cognitive abilities and psychological functioning by comparing them to other individuals. These types of tests can be administered to both children and grownups. They are typically used to evaluate the existence of particular psychological health conditions like stress and anxiety, depression, attention deficit disorder (ADHD), and bipolar affective disorder. They can likewise be used to measure the efficiency of treatments such as psychiatric therapy and medication.
Clinical interviews are a fundamental part of the psychological examination session, and it's vital for a person to be truthful and open with their evaluator. They will ask a range of questions related to the client's sensations and ideas, consisting of for how long they have actually been experiencing signs and what types of coping methods they have tried in the past. They will likewise desire to understand if the signs have altered gradually, and they will wish to understand any way of life factors that may have contributed to them such as drug or alcohol usage, sleep routines, diet, and workout.
Psychological assessment sessions can likewise involve informal tests or surveys and interview information, medical examinations, school records, and observational data depending on the needs of the person being evaluated. For example, if the critic is assessing a student, they might also administer tests to examine discovering difficulties or giftedness.
What Types of Psychological Tests Are Used in a Psychological Assessment?
Psychological tests are professionally developed instruments that measure different capabilities, abilities and personality traits or qualities. The types of psychological tests used in a psychological assessment consist of, however are not limited to: intelligence or IQ tests, scholastic capability (or accomplishment) tests, thorough tests measuring particular cognitive functions such as memory, attention span and visual/motor coordination, online neurocognitive tests and character tests such as the MMPI-2 and DISC evaluations.
Psychologists often utilize the data collected from these psychological tests to help people much better comprehend their own strengths and weak points. Having this understanding can empower individuals to make up for the recorded weakness and work to enhance their total mental health. Psychologists likewise use this information to produce a customized treatment plan for each specific client.
For instance, psychologists may suggest a person take a particular medication or behavior modification to assist attend to a particular anxiety condition. Similarly, they may recommend an individual participate in group therapy sessions to help deal with depression. Psychologists will also use this data to track an individual's development gradually.
In addition to psychological testing, psychologists might likewise use direct observational approaches to observe a person's habits. For example, they may view a kid communicate with their peers or parents to understand the nature of a relationship issue. They might likewise record a person's response to a concern over time to comprehend their psychological reactions.

Who Can Administer a Psychological Test?
Psychological evaluations are administered by licensed psychologists who have been trained to assess and comprehend the complex relationships in between brain-behavior. Depending upon the type of assessment needed, these specialists can specialize in particular areas like clinical psychology, neuropsychology, or developmental and school-based psychological testing.
The primary step of an evaluation is typically a personal first meeting with the psychologist. This is a possibility for the psychologist to listen to your concerns, what you have attempted so far and your expect the future. They will likewise take a comprehensive psychological health history, which may include your previous experiences with psychiatric treatment, family or substantial relationships, youth events, and existing coping methods.
As soon as this information is collected, the psychologist will choose a proper "battery" of tests for the person. These tests will be matched to the person's providing issues and created to supply clear, precise, and actionable outcomes. The testing session can last for a couple of hours or more, and the results will frequently be broken down into various areas. These sections may be cognitive/academic, psychological and behavioral, visual-spatial ability, fine and gross motor skills, and adaptive functional abilities.
A written report is then produced by the psychologist using the information gathered during testing, clinical interviews, and observations. The resulting report will be an extensive file detailing the psychologist's findings and their suggestions. This is a fundamental part of the procedure and ought to be evaluated thoroughly.
